Servings:
Makes 9 servings, about 3/4 cup each.
Ingredient list
70 NILLA Wafers
¼ cup walnut pieces
5 eggs
1¼ cups milk
2 Tbsp. granulated sugar
½ tsp. ground cinnamon
⅛ tsp. ground nutmeg
2 Tbsp. butter
2 Tbsp. brown sugar
½ cup maple syrup
2 bananas
Directions
1
Heat oven to 350°F.
2
Place wafers evenly in 1-1/2-qt. casserole dish sprayed with cooking spray; sprinkle with nuts.
3
Whisk eggs, milk, granulated sugar and spices until blended; pour over ingredients in casserole dish. If necessary, use back of spoon to gently press wafers into egg mixture so all are evenly coated with egg mixture.
4
Bake 30 to 35 min. or until knife inserted in center comes out clean.
5
Meanwhile, cook butter and brown sugar in large skillet on medium heat until butter is completely melted and mixture is well blended, stirring occasionally. Stir in maple syrup. Bring to boil; reduce heat to low. Slice bananas; add to skillet. Stir to evenly coat banana slices with sugar mixture. Cook and stir 1 to 2 min. or until heated through.
6
Serve "French Toast" topped with banana mixture.
Recipe Tips
Size WiseThis dessert is the perfect complement to a weekend brunch or bridal shower menu.
SubstitutePrepare using maple-flavored or pancake syrup.
SubstitutePrepare using pecan pieces.
